Space Saver Rowing Systems and Diarmuid Fehily present: THE WRAPTOR BALANCE What is it and what does it do? The Wraptor Balance is a floatation device which can fit to any of your boats and clips on and off with ease. It is used to train rowers in the art of balancing the boat, helping them maintain speed and direction. It’s light, durable, and it’s use spans all levels of rowing. We identified 3 big challenges we know coaches face, and a few ways to tackle them.  The success of a coach is not only about their technical skills but also balancing their relationship with the athletes they coach. 1. Communication Why it’s important: Knowing how to communicate with your athletes means they will understand your instructions to improve, and your purpose in getting them to do each activity.
